Varsity Volleyball Wins 2nd Place in State

Calvary Christian continued its march toward a second straight
state volleyball title with first- and second-round wins Friday in the Georgia Independent School Association tournament at George Walton Academy.

The Lady Knights swept Mount Vernon Presbyterian 25-10, 25-9, 25-7, then prevailed over Westminster Christian 25-23, 29-31, 25-8, 25-17.

On Saturday the Lady Knights beat Young American Christian academy in the semi finals advancing to the finals. The Lady Knights fell short of their 2nd state Championship title with a loss to Pinecrest Academy in the finals.

They won their semifinal against Young American Christian 25-21, 23-25, 25-10, 25-9. The Lady Knights lost 20-25, 25-18, 28-26, 25-22 to Pinecrest Academy in the Georgia Independent School Association championship match.

 

Coach Chris Akers said he is proud of his players’ effort, especially because Pinecrest had swept two matches from them during the regular season when one of their outside hitters was sidelined. “They played with reckless abandon, gave everything they had,” he said. “We had every chance to win that match, but we just didn’t get the breaks we needed.”

Leaders (combined for both days): Olivia Whitehurst 52 kills, 45 digs, 9 aces, 3 blocks; Ivey Roper 122 assists, 10 kills, 19 digs, 5 aces; McKenzie Bragg 51 kills, 9 blocks, 4 aces, 4 digs; Caytlin Merritt 52 digs, 10 aces.



Varsity Girls WIN Volleyball Tournament!

The CCS varsity girls volleyball team won the Lady Eagle Volleyball Tournament at Sherwood Academy on October 10,
with a 4-0 record. The Lady Knights beat Ridgecrest 25-5, 25-11, Sherwood 25-7, 25-12 and George Walton 25-7, 25-15, in the
title match.

McKenzie Bragg was the tournament MVP. She joined Ivy Roper and Mary McCarty on the all-tourney team.

Varsity Girls Finish Second in Augusta
Volleyball Tournament


Calvary Christian finished second in the Augusta Prep invitational tournament, falling to Pinecrest 25-18, 25-21 in the championship match.

Calvary went 4-3 in the tournament, beating Frederica Academy 25-9, 25-11, Harvester Christian 25-20, 25-14, Augusta Prep 27-25, 25-20 and Pinewood 28-27, 20-25, 15-6. The other two losses were to Augusta Prep 25-18, 25-16 and Pinecrest 25-19, 25-20.

Individuals—Calvary: McKenzie Bragg 36 kills, 9 aces, 6 blocks; Ivey Roper 20 kills, 8 digs, 3 aces, 54 assists; Caytlin Merritt 47 digs; Leslie Dupree 36 assists, 5 digs, 4 aces; Alana Roper 16 kills, 51 digs, 7 aces.
